Kate Schatz – Where the Girls Were Talk & Reading
March 4 @ 2:30 pm - 4:00 pm | Humanities 1, Room 210
Join UCSC alum Kate Schatz, bestselling author of the Rad Women series, for a reading from her new novel Where the Girls Were and a Q & A on writing, creativity, and growing up amid political and cultural change.
Blending sharp cultural insight with emotional depth, Schatz’s work explores how young women navigate creativity, power, and identity in a world shaped by social movements and personal reckonings. The event will include a reading, followed by a Q & A conversation about her writing process, themes, and career.
